Do you need a driver's licence to get around Chilliwack on a scooter?

Many citizens are a little perplexed when it comes to the rules of the road when operating everything from electric bikes to motorized wheelchairs.

City of Chilliwack's Safer City team is holding an open house event to answer questions at City Hall in partnership with RCMP on Thursday, April 18 at 5:30 p.m.

They'll be discussing electric bicycles, both electric and gas-powered scooters, as well as motorized wheelchairs.

Electric bikes will be on display for the open house, provided by City Scooters, said city officials.
